10. Fitzroy Island Resort, for a beachside venue

Photo via Fitzroy Island Resort
Photo via Matthew Evans Photography

Planning to have a beach or resort wedding in Australia? Fitzroy Island Resort is the perfect place. Launched in 2010, the resort is the official operator of this 339 hectares tranquil paradise. Most of the land is reserved for nature conservation so expect a strong nature ambiance in the place. Fitzroy Island is such a pristine place, a pro-nature resort equipped with the modern convenience, it’s the area where the rainforest meets the corals.

9. Corowa Whisky and Chocolate, for an old yet memorable place

Photo via John Mitchell Photography
Photo via John Mitchell Photography

If you’re looking forward to a classic looking wedding venue, Better settle things up and tie knots at Corowa Whisky and Chocolate. It’s a 1920’s looking flour mill, distillery, and chocolate factory in Corowa. The place produces an odd classic flavor to the eyes of the guest on your wedding day. This might a bit old, but as the time flies, they keep on restoring it unique architecture.

7. Shene Estate & Distillery, for vintage theme wedding

Photo via Justin Ma Wedding
Photo via Discover Tasmania

Shene Estate & Distillery is a marvelous place for a wine lover couples.  This 197 years old estate and distillery that will add a vintage flavor on your wedding venue. Yet it may look vintage but the venue offers many modern conveniences. Upon celebrating your special day here will take you back in time where every moment will become historic. They also offer different wines that can be served on your wedding day.

6. Glasshaus Inside, for a wedding inside the greenhouse

Photo via Motta Weddings
Photo via WedShed

The owner Paul Hyland has been a grower of rare flowers and plants for over 20 years. From their innovative way of thinking they developed a very romantic venue, a flower nursery that is perfect if you’re looking forward to a flowery garden themed wedding. They also offer a wide range of services such as offers a variety of services centered around landscaping, conceptualizing and styling. They use plant ornaments as a design for your wedding.

5. The Lock-Up, for an old yet amazing place

Photo via WedShed
Photo via Sofia in Australia

Art centred location, situated in one of the Newcastle’s most significant heritage buildings.  The Lock-Up is a multidisciplinary contemporary arts space and inner city hub for creative thinking and doing. So for couples looking forward to deep artistic themed wedding venue better settle it at the The Lock-Up. This place might a bit old but they preserve it as a unique Australian wedding venue for anyone.

2. Willie Smith’s Apple Shed, for wedding ceremony inside a barn

Photo via Snappy Street
Photo via Wenditas

Willie Smith’s Apple Shed is a bar-styled wedding venue.  The vision started in 1988, and four generations after, Willie Smith’s Apple Shed is now amongst the best romantic wedding destination in Australia. Sundays at the shed are all about good food and delicious beverages. Get surrounded by apple plantations teeming with apple fruits on your wedding day. You can also hire their live band to play on your wedding day. It can also hold up a big wedding event.

1. Yarrangobilly Caves House, for an exceptional wedding inside the cave

Photo via National Parks
Photo via The Bride’s Diary

Do you want an exceptional wedding in Australia? You can have a wedding inside a cave! Have your wedding unfold at the most beautiful and tranquil limestone cave. Explore the depths of Yarrangobilly Caves and discover the amazing stalagmites, stalactites and delicate decorations like shawls and cave corals. do some deep adventures inside six caves created from a belt of limestone laid down about 440 million years ago.

St Joseph’s Guest House, for an exclusive place

Photo via EasyWeddings
Photo via WedShed

St Joseph’s Guest House creation of Steve Kavanagh, he’s the one who saw the potential of the ruins of a 1800’s Catholic Church. The building has been passionately and delicately restored and turned into a stunning venue. It houses four king bedrooms complete with air conditioning and ensuite bathrooms.

Old Melbourne Gaol, for a classic and historical venue

Photo via Mark Dayman Photography
Photo via Weddings of Distiction

Between 1842 and its closure in 1929 the gaol was became one of the historic spot in Australia. But the place has its dark past it’s the scene of 133 hangings including Australia’s most infamous citizen, the bushranger Ned Kelly. It’s a perfect wedding location if your looking forward for an odd mysterious wedding theme.

The Barn, for exclusive yet ashtonishing venue

Photo via South Coast Bride
Photo via Bridal Musings

Located 15 minutes drive away from the historic village of Milton on the South Coast of NSW, The Barn at Clyde Ridge bears breathtaking views of Pigeon House Mountain and the Budawang Ranges. Surrounded by beautiful gardens, the venue provides a perfect backdrop for your wedding day.

Clifftop, for a cool outdoor wedding

Photo via Clifftop
Photo via Lens to life

Located just 90 minutes from the Melbourne CBD, Clifftop Phillip Island location is one-of-a-kind. Tucked between sea and sky offering your guest the view of the elegant Smiths Beach, Pyramid Rock and the Bass Strait on one side, and on the other, and rich green farmland. Surrounded by native tranquil vegetation Clifftop not only offers magical scenic views, visitors will be amazed at the wildlife that makes its home in this beautiful spot.
